Pozuelo is divided into distinct neighborhoods, each with its own character. La Finca is renowned for exceptional privacy and prominent residents, featuring state-of-the-art villas with extensive grounds. Somosaguas combines tradition and modernity amidst established gardens, while Monteclaro attracts families with its community focus and quality educational options. The whole of Pozuelo benefits from robust infrastructure, smooth connections to city and airport, and a discreet neighborhood feel.

Pozuelo de Alarcón enjoys a Mediterranean climate marked by warm, dry summers and mild winters. The region benefits from high annual sunshine hours, favoring year-round outdoor living and recreation. Evenings are generally comfortable, and rainfall is limited, supporting lush gardens and al fresco social life across the seasons without the extremes found in some other climates.
